BROADSIDE: TEA TAX, 1773.
Broadside proclamation by the Sons of Liberty at Philadelphia, 7 December 1773 (nine days before the Boston Tea Party), warning the captain of the tea ship Polly of a tarring and feathering if her cargo is unloaded.
